2013-02-08 66 views
2

好像我不能用在Amazon CloudFront定製的起源和cross-domain XMLHttpRequest因爲CloudFront的前不需額外的預檢OPTIONS請求按照第HTTP方法Request and Response Behavior, and Supported HTTP Status Codes for Custom OriginsCloudfront是否不支持CORS與自定義來源?

CloudFront的只接受GETHEAD來自最終用戶的請求。

我找不到任何人在網上抱怨這件事,任何人都可以證實這一點嗎?

+0

難道你不需要預檢未獲取請求嗎? – 2013-02-09 14:30:53

+1

是的,但chrome會在發出GET之前發出OPTIONS請求。 – 2013-02-12 20:29:39

回答

2

CloudFront的現在支持以下請求(包括OPTIONS):

  • DELETE
  • GET
  • HEAD
  • OPTIONS
  • PATCH
  • POST
  • PUT

HTTP方法該問題中引用的CloudFront documentation部分已更新。

+1

最後。感謝您的發現。 – 2013-11-02 23:31:05

+1

它仍然不能與緩存命中一起使用,只能在緩存未命中時使用。 – nikolay 2014-04-07 20:50:17

+0

@nikolay是否會擊敗CDN的目的,如果它與緩存命中一起工作? – Nate 2014-07-18 14:13:29

相關問題